Integral as a Function of the Upper Limit to Solve Axial Symmetrical Rod Drawing and Extrusion 被引量:1

摘要 A kinematically admissible velocity field which is different from Avitzur's has been proposed for axial symmetrical rod drawing and extrusion.An upper-bound analytical solution in cylindrical coordinates has been obtained without any mathematical simplification in this paper.
